Whitchurch is a market town and civil parish in north Shropshire, England, close to the borders of Cheshire and Wales. It lies near the towns of Wem, Nantwich, Malpas, and Audlem, and within easy reach of Wrexham and Chester. The town is situated near the Whitchurch Arm of the Shropshire Union Canal and is bypassed by the A41 and A525 roads.

*Guides are provided as an indication of each seller's minimum expectation. They are not necessarily figures which a property will sell for and may change at any time prior to the auction. Each property will be offered subject to a RESERVE (a figure below which the Auctioneer cannot sell the property during the auction) which we expect will be set within the Guide Range or no more than 10% above a single figure Guide.

You usually pay Stamp Duty Land Tax (SDLT) on increasing portions of the property price above £125,000 when you buy residential property, eg a house or flat.
There are different rules if you’re buying your first home and the purchase price is £500,000 or less.
You’ll usually have to pay 3% on top of the normal SDLT rates if buying a new residential property means you’ll own more than one.
You won’t pay the extra 3% SDLT if the property you’re buying is replacing your main residence and that has already been sold.
